Britain’s Fittest Farmer was launched by Farmers Weekly in 2018 as a fun way of sparking a vital discussion about the physical and mental health of the nation’s farmers.

 

The competition is designed to encourage farmers to focus on both their physical and mental health, ensuring they are in peak condition to manage and run their farm businesses effectively.

 

Farming can also be an isolating job, which is why it is also vital for farmers to focus on their own mental health and wellbeing so that they can keep their business in tip-top condition too.

 

The search is on to find four individuals who will be crowned Britain’s Fittest Farmers 2025 in each of the four categories: Men under 40, Women under 40, Men over 40 and Women over 40, with the coveted trophy and a £1,000 cash prize for each winner.
